ibv_query_qp

Gets the attributes of a queue pair (QP).

Syntax

#include <rdma/verbs.h>
int ibv_query_qp(struct ibv_qp *qp, struct ibv_qp_attr *attr,
                 int attr_mask,
                 struct ibv_qp_init_attr *init_attr);

Description

The ibv_query_qp() gets the attributes specified in attr_mask for the QP and returns them through the pointers attr and init_attr. The argument attr is an ibv_qp_attr struct, as defined in <rdma/verbs.h>.
struct ibv_qp_attr {
enum ibv_qp_state       qp_state;            /* Current QP state */
enum ibv_qp_state       cur_qp_state;        /* Current QP state - irrelevant for ibv_query_qp */
enum ibv_mtu            path_mtu;            /* Path MTU (valid only for RC/UC QPs) */
enum ibv_mig_state      path_mig_state;      /* Path migration state (valid if HCA supports APM) */
uint32_t                qkey;                /* Q_Key of the QP (valid only for UD QPs) */
uint32_t                rq_psn;              /* PSN for receive queue (valid only for RC/UC QPs) */
uint32_t                sq_psn;              /* PSN for send queue (valid only for RC/UC QPs) */
uint32_t                dest_qp_num;         /* Destination QP number (valid only for RC/UC QPs) */
int                     qp_access_flags;     /* Mask of enabled remote access operations (valid only 
                                                for RC/UC QPs) */
struct ibv_qp_cap       cap;                 /* QP capabilities */
struct ibv_ah_attr      ah_attr;             /* Primary path address vector (valid only for RC/UC QPs) */
struct ibv_ah_attr      alt_ah_attr;         /* Alternate path address vector (valid only for RC/UC QPs) */
uint16_t                pkey_index;          /* Primary P_Key index */
uint16_t                alt_pkey_index;      /* Alternate P_Key index */
uint8_t                 en_sqd_async_notify; /* Enable SQD.drained async notification - irrelevant for 
                                                ibv_query_qp */
uint8_t                 sq_draining;         /* Is the QP draining? (Valid only if qp_state is SQD) */
uint8_t                 max_rd_atomic;       /* Number of outstanding RDMA reads & atomic operations 
                                                on the destination QP (valid only for RC QPs) */
uint8_t                 max_dest_rd_atomic;  /* Number of responder resources for handling incoming
                                                RDMA reads & atomic operations (valid only for 
                                                RC QPs) */
uint8_t                 min_rnr_timer;       /* Minimum RNR NAK timer (valid only for RC QPs) */
uint8_t                 port_num;            /* Primary port number */
uint8_t                 timeout;             /* Local ack timeout for primary path (valid only 
                                                for RC QPs) */
uint8_t                 retry_cnt;           /* Retry count (valid only for RC QPs) */
uint8_t                 rnr_retry;           /* RNR retry (valid only for RC QPs) */
uint8_t                 alt_port_num;        /* Alternate port number */
uint8_t                 alt_timeout;         /* Local ack timeout for alternate path (valid only
                                                for RC QPs) */
};

For details on struct ibv_qp_cap(), see the description of ibv_create_qp function. For details on struct ibv_ah_attr, see the description of ibv_create_ah() function.

Return Values

On success, the ibv_query_qp() function returns 0, or the errno on failure that indicates the reason for failure.
